नारद–शुक संवादः (Nārada–Śuka Dialogue): Tyāga, Saṃyama, and Vyakta–Avyakta Viveka

स्थिरत्वादिन्द्रियाणां तु निश्चलत्वात्‌ तथैव च | एवं युक्तस्य तु मुनेर्लक्षणान्युपलक्षयेत्‌

sthiratvād indriyāṇāṁ tu niścalatvāt tathaiva ca | evaṁ yuktasya tu muner lakṣaṇāny upalakṣayet ||

諸根(indriya)が安定し、また心が不動であるがゆえに、このようにヨーガに結ばれた牟尼(muni)の徴を見定めるべきである。かかる規律ある修行者は高き集中に住し、乱れの中にあっても三昧(samādhi)より滑り落ちない。その内なる泰然は、諸機能の揺るぎない安定によって知られる。

Educational Q&A

The core teaching is that the authentic sign of yogic attainment is unwavering steadiness: when the senses are stabilized and the mind is unshaken, the sage remains established in samādhi despite external provocations.

Yājñavalkya is instructing about how to पहचान/recognize (upalakṣayet) a truly disciplined muni: not by outward display, but by the inner criterion of stable senses and an immovable mind that does not fall away from meditative absorption.
